  • Viúvas da Eternidade – Nenhum Túmulo Pode Conter Seu Nome
    A C minor, 58 BPM blues/doom elegy where a dark contralto turns a graveside vigil into a credo against entropy. Hammond swells, slide laments, and slow, heavy drums lift a Portuguese refrain into an enduring invocation that insists memory outlives stone.
  • Viúvas da Eternidade – Lágrimas Imortais Têm Sabor de Vinho
    An immortal toast turned doom-blues ritual, Portuguese lyrics and a smoky contralto map grief onto wine, from shuttered taverns to fading stars. Slide guitar, Hammond swells, and a blues-metal climax underscore a meditation on memory’s fermentation and the curse of never forgetting.
  • Viúvas da Eternidade – A Meia-Noite Não Ama Ninguém
    A doom-soaked Portuguese blues where midnight becomes a god of absence, a contralto voice traces grief from a dim room to collapsing empires, then back to a bed where night wears a lost face. Slow E-minor slide, Hammond organ, and a crushing doom-blues swell seal its fatal thesis.
